SpaceX Continues Its Stellar Journey: Latest Starlink Deployment and Innovations

SpaceX successfully launched 25 Starlink satellites into orbit from the Vandenberg Space Force Base in California. The Falcon 9 rocket lifted off from Launch Complex 4E on January 22 at 05:47 GMT (21:47 local time on January 21). Approximately an hour after launch, the upper stage of Falcon 9 deployed the Starlink payload (known as Group 17-30) into the designated orbit. The deployment of 25 Starlink satellites was confirmed by SpaceX on social media.

Photo: SpaceX

The first stage of Falcon 9, known as Booster 1093, completed its 13th flight, successfully landing on the drone ship Of Course I Still Love You in the Pacific Ocean. This new batch of satellites enhances the Starlink constellation, which currently consists of around 9,500 active satellites. The launch on January 22 marked the ninth for SpaceX in 2026 and the 592nd since 2010.
